## Further Reading: The Great Cron Drift of Bramblehook

Short version: our scheduler's clock drifted, jobs fired late, and a few overlapped in fun ways. We now sync against the Tallow time service and alert on skew over 200ms. The full write-up, including the overlap locking fix, lives on the page below.

operations page: https://confluence.tolvaqsys.corp/spaces/pages/pages/6e787158f507

14:22 — Offline sync regression confirmed (Terrapath field-survey app)

At 14:22 the on-call engineer reproduced the data-loss path: surveys saved while offline were marked synced once connectivity returned, even when the upload was rejected. The queue flush skipped the server acknowledgement check introduced in the previous sprint. Release manager note: the fix must ship before the coastal survey season. The offending build is identified by the token recorded below.

session token of kawif-fawig = htk31_f3f599be2b1a34affb1efa8d0feccf8

Handover Note — Headcount Planning

Hi Renna,

Welcome aboard! Quick rundown before I move to the Kelvane office. Next year's plan sits at 42 new roles: 18 engineering for the Orliss platform, 12 field sales, the rest split between ops and support. Finance already blessed the first two quarters; H2 is soft until revenue checkpoints clear. Marta in People Ops has the tracker and is a gem — lean on her. The bigger context you'll need is captured just below.

Cheers, Dovan

board note of bawep-tajef: Queniusek Systems plans to raise the Quenvan list price by 53.1 percent in March. The pricing group signed off on a budget of $176.4 million for Project Drueth. The renewal with Casionix Partners closes at $142.5 million a year, 8.3 percent below the last contract. Project Fraax slips by six weeks because of the tooling delay.

Load test: Cartwheel checkout flow, pre-release gate for v4.2. Run the Hammerfall suite against staging for 20 minutes at 300 RPS, ramping from 50. Abort if p99 exceeds 900ms or error rate passes 0.5%. Payment stubs must be enabled; never hit the live Tollgate processor. The staging service must run with the following configuration before the test starts.

deployment values, faduf-tawep:
SORDOR_LOG_LEVEL=error
SORDOR_METRICS_HOST=metrics.sordor.nelvrolabs.internal
SORDOR_POOL_SIZE=4